Common Admission Requirements For Esthetician SchoolsIn Avenal, California

To enroll in esthetician programs in Avenal, prospective students must meet certain admission criteria. Here’s a general list of requirements:

  • Minimum Age: Students usually need to be at least 18 years old or have parental approval for enrollment.

  • High School Diploma or GED: A diploma or equivalent is often required as a prerequisite for admission.

  • Prerequisite Coursework: Some schools may encourage or require coursework in biology, chemistry, or health sciences to provide a foundational knowledge base in skin care.

  • Application Materials: A completed application form, personal essay, and letters of recommendation may be part of the admission process.

  • Interview Process: Some programs might require an in-person or virtual interview to assess your passion for skincare and suitability for the field.

  • Health Considerations: Proof of immunizations and a clean health record may be required to ensure a safe learning environment.

Students should check specific schools for exact requirements, as they may vary by program.

Esthetician Salary in California
Annual Median: $37,170
Hourly Median: $17.87
Data sourced from Career One Stop, provided by the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ics wage estimates.
PercentileAnnual Salary
10th$33,050
25th$35,030
Median$37,170
75th$46,820
90th$64,000

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Esthetician Schools In Avenal, California

  1. What is the duration of esthetician programs in Avenal?

    • Most programs typically last between 600 to 1,200 hours, or around six months to one year.
  2. Do I need a license to work as an esthetician in California?

    • Yes, you must pass the California State Board of Barbering and Cosmetology exam to obtain your esthetician license.
  3. What skills will I learn in an esthetician program?

    • You will learn skincare techniques, makeup application, product knowledge, sanitation protocols, and client consultation skills.
  4. Are there part-time programs available?

    • Yes, some schools offer flexible scheduling, including evening and weekend classes.
  5. What are the job prospects after graduation?

    • Esthetician graduates can expect good job prospects due to growing demand in the beauty industry.
  6. Can I specialize in specific areas of skincare?

    • Yes, students can choose to specialize in areas like makeup artistry, medical esthetics, or skincare product sales.
  7. What are the continuing education requirements for estheticians?

    • California requires estheticians to renew their licenses every two years, which may involve completing continuing education hours.
